Historical Significance of Operation Anthropoid
The "Prague: In the Footsteps of Operation Anthropoid" tour not only explores significant locations but also sheds light on the profound historical impact of the operation itself.
This daring mission, executed by Czechoslovakian resistance fighters in May 1942, aimed to assassinate Reinhard Heydrich, a key Nazi leader. The successful execution of Operation Anthropoid not only marked a pivotal moment in World War II but also symbolized the bravery and sacrifice of those who opposed tyranny.
The repercussions were immense, leading to brutal reprisals against civilians, particularly in Lidice, which was obliterated in retaliation. This operation inspired resistance across Europe, reminding future generations of the cost of freedom and the indomitable spirit of those who fought against oppression.
Key Sites Along the Tour
One can hardly overlook the profound significance of the key sites visited during the "Prague: In the Footsteps of Operation Anthropoid" tour. Each location offers a haunting glimpse into the bravery of those who resisted tyranny. The Church of St. Cyril and St. Methodius served as a refuge for resistance fighters, while the crypt became a site of tragic sacrifice. Visitors walk the very streets where Reinhard Heydrich was assassinated, and the somber memory of Lidice resonates through its memorials.
Site | Significance |
---|---|
Church of St. Cyril and St. Methodius | Hiding place for resistance fighters |
Crypt | Location of the fighters’ final stand |
Assassination Site | Where Heydrich was attacked |
Panenské Březany | Heydrich’s residence |
Lidice | Town erased in retaliation, memorial site |
